He produced over 60 plays mainly addressing the pressing social issues of the day in england including class privilege, education, marriage, religion, government, and health care, but he was most concerned about the exploitation of working class people. Although his first profitable writing was music and literary criticism, in which capacity he wrote many highly articulate pieces of journalism, his main talent was for drama, and he wrote more than 60 plays.
